4.1 Essential Safety Measures
Ensuring safety during installation is paramount to prevent accidents and injuries. Always wear appropriate protective gear‚ including gloves‚ safety glasses‚ and a dust mask. Properly handle power tools by following the manufacturer’s guidelines. Keep loose clothing and long hair tied back to avoid entanglements. Ensure the workspace is well-ventilated and free from clutter. If working at heights‚ use sturdy ladders and maintain three points of contact. Never override safety features on equipment. Keep children and pets away from the installation area. Turn off power supplies before starting electrical work. Regularly inspect tools for damage and ensure they are in good working condition. Adhere to all safety warnings provided in the installation manual.
